[FUG-BR] RES: como fazer um controle de banda DUPLO

2008-01-09 Por tôpico Cobausque
Ei uma duvida .. porque no script você usa no queue 6,4Kbytes por exemplo
pro micro com 64K em ???
E assim respectivamente?

-Mensagem original-
De: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] Em nome
de Alessandro de Souza Rocha
Enviada em: segunda-feira, 7 de janeiro de 2008 19:14
Para: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)
Assunto: Re: [FUG-BR] como fazer um controle de banda DUPLO

Em 07/01/08, Samyr Alves[EMAIL PROTECTED] escreveu:
 Ola Amigo,

 da uma olhada em

 http://www.openbsd.org/faq/pf/pt/queueing.html

 sds
 samyr


 Em 07/01/08, Alex Almeida [EMAIL PROTECTED] escreveu:
 
  Boa tarde a todos, é o seguinte gostaria de entender como fazer um
  controle de banda DUPLO, vou tentar exemplificar isso abaixo:
 
  O cliente compra o serviço de internet de 256kbits, porem quer que seja
  limitada a banda de determinados ips na sua rede:
 
  Rede do cliente: 192.168.0.0/29 (1 gateway + 5 ips) - 256kbits
 
  192.168.0.2 - IP 1 - Limitado ate 128kbits
  192.168.0.3 - IP 2 - Limitado ate 64kbits
  192.168.0.4 - IP 3 - Limitado ate 64kbits
  192.168.0.5 - IP 4 - Limitado ate 256kbits
  192.168.0.6 - IP 5 - Limitado ate 256kbits
 
  O total deste IPs acima dará 768kbits porem a banda total do link
  fornecido será de 256kbits, no momento que algum usuário necessitar
  utilizar a banda ele ficara limitado a velocidade disponível no momento.
  Exemplo:
 
  o IP .4 vai efetuar um download com ate 64kbits, mesmo que o link esteja
  todo livre no momento.
  o IP .5 vai efetuar um download com ate 256kbits, se o link estiver todo
  livre no momento, caso contrario o próprio roteamento faz o
balanceamento.
 
  No aguardo,
 
  Alex Almeida
 
 
  -
  Histórico: http://www.fug.com.br/historico/html/freebsd/
  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
 



 --
 QQ duvida estarei aki para ajudar, obrigado, t+

 []´s, Samyr Alves
 Gd Internet
 Analista de Redes e Telecomunicação
 NOC - Network Operation Center
 E-mail / MSN Messenger: [EMAIL PROTECTED]
 Web Site: www.gd.com.br
 Office + 55 75 3223 5018
 Toll Free   0800 701 5018
 Mobile + 55 75 8127 2320
 Feira de Santana - Bahia - Brazil

 - Em qualquer situação e diante de qualquer circunstância, preserve a
 integridade do seu caráter
 -
 Histórico: http://www.fug.com.br/historico/html/freebsd/
 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d


ipfw add 1000 pipe 1 src-ip 192.168.0.2 out
ipfw add 1100 pipe 2 dst-ip 192.168.0.2  in
ipfw pipe 1 config mask src-ip 0x00ff bw 128Kbit/s queue 12,8KBytes
ipfw pipe 2 config mask dst-ip 0x00ff bw 128Kbit/s queue 12,8KBytes

ipfw add 1001 pipe 3 src-ip 192.168.0.3 out
ipfw add 1102 pipe 4 dst-ip 192.168.0.3 in
ipfw pipe 1 config mask src-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
ipfw pipe 2 config mask dst-ip 0x00ff bw 64Kbit/s queue 6,4KBytes

ipfw add 1003 pipe 5 src-ip 192.168.0.4 out
ipfw add 1104 pipe 6 dst-ip 192.168.0.4 in
ipfw pipe 1 config mask src-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
ipfw pipe 2 config mask dst-ip 0x00ff bw 64Kbit/s queue 6,4KBytes

-- 
Alessandro de Souza Rocha
Administrador de Redes e Sistemas
Freebsd-BR User #117
-
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d

No virus found in this incoming message.
Checked by AVG Free Edition. 
Version: 7.5.516 / Virus Database: 269.17.13/1214 - Release Date: 08/01/2008
13:38
 

No virus found in this outgoing message.
Checked by AVG Free Edition. 
Version: 7.5.516 / Virus Database: 269.17.13/1214 - Release Date: 08/01/2008
13:38
 

-
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d


Re: [FUG-BR] RES: como fazer um controle de banda DUPLO

2008-01-09 Por tôpico Wanderson Tinti
Nesse howto em portugues explica de forma clara como funciona o
calculo da fila queue.
De uma olhada, está na página: 38 onde fala de: Filas de tuneis (pipe queues).

http://www.freebsdbrasil.com.br/fbsdbr_files/File/public_docs/ipfw-howto.pdf


Até mais.


Em 09/01/08, Marcio Antunes[EMAIL PROTECTED] escreveu:
 não seria pq 6,4 é Kbytes e 64 é kbits. ??

 Em 09/01/08, Cobausque[EMAIL PROTECTED] escreveu:
  Ei uma duvida .. porque no script você usa no queue 6,4Kbytes por exemplo
  pro micro com 64K em ???
  E assim respectivamente?
 
  -Mensagem original-
  De: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] Em nome
  de Alessandro de Souza Rocha
  Enviada em: segunda-feira, 7 de janeiro de 2008 19:14
  Para: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)
  Assunto: Re: [FUG-BR] como fazer um controle de banda DUPLO
  
  Em 07/01/08, Samyr Alves[EMAIL PROTECTED] escreveu:
   Ola Amigo,
  
   da uma olhada em
  
   http://www.openbsd.org/faq/pf/pt/queueing.html
  
   sds
   samyr
  
  
   Em 07/01/08, Alex Almeida [EMAIL PROTECTED] escreveu:
   
Boa tarde a todos, é o seguinte gostaria de entender como fazer um
controle de banda DUPLO, vou tentar exemplificar isso abaixo:
   
O cliente compra o serviço de internet de 256kbits, porem quer que seja
limitada a banda de determinados ips na sua rede:
   
Rede do cliente: 192.168.0.0/29 (1 gateway + 5 ips) - 256kbits
   
192.168.0.2 - IP 1 - Limitado ate 128kbits
192.168.0.3 - IP 2 - Limitado ate 64kbits
192.168.0.4 - IP 3 - Limitado ate 64kbits
192.168.0.5 - IP 4 - Limitado ate 256kbits
192.168.0.6 - IP 5 - Limitado ate 256kbits
   
O total deste IPs acima dará 768kbits porem a banda total do link
fornecido será de 256kbits, no momento que algum usuário necessitar
utilizar a banda ele ficara limitado a velocidade disponível no momento.
Exemplo:
   
o IP .4 vai efetuar um download com ate 64kbits, mesmo que o link esteja
todo livre no momento.
o IP .5 vai efetuar um download com ate 256kbits, se o link estiver todo
livre no momento, caso contrario o próprio roteamento faz o
  balanceamento.
   
No aguardo,
   
Alex Almeida
   
   
-
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
   
  
  
  
   --
   QQ duvida estarei aki para ajudar, obrigado, t+
  
   []´s, Samyr Alves
   Gd Internet
   Analista de Redes e Telecomunicação
   NOC - Network Operation Center
   E-mail / MSN Messenger: [EMAIL PROTECTED]
   Web Site: www.gd.com.br
   Office + 55 75 3223 5018
   Toll Free   0800 701 5018
   Mobile + 55 75 8127 2320
   Feira de Santana - Bahia - Brazil
  
   - Em qualquer situação e diante de qualquer circunstância, preserve a
   integridade do seu caráter
   -
   Histórico: http://www.fug.com.br/historico/html/freebsd/
   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
  
 
  ipfw add 1000 pipe 1 src-ip 192.168.0.2 out
  ipfw add 1100 pipe 2 dst-ip 192.168.0.2  in
  ipfw pipe 1 config mask src-ip 0x00ff bw 128Kbit/s queue 12,8KBytes
  ipfw pipe 2 config mask dst-ip 0x00ff bw 128Kbit/s queue 12,8KBytes
 
  ipfw add 1001 pipe 3 src-ip 192.168.0.3 out
  ipfw add 1102 pipe 4 dst-ip 192.168.0.3 in
  ipfw pipe 1 config mask src-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
  ipfw pipe 2 config mask dst-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
 
  ipfw add 1003 pipe 5 src-ip 192.168.0.4 out
  ipfw add 1104 pipe 6 dst-ip 192.168.0.4 in
  ipfw pipe 1 config mask src-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
  ipfw pipe 2 config mask dst-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
 
  --
  Alessandro de Souza Rocha
  Administrador de Redes e Sistemas
  Freebsd-BR User #117
  -
  Histórico: http://www.fug.com.br/historico/html/freebsd/
  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
 
  No virus found in this incoming message.
  Checked by AVG Free Edition.
  Version: 7.5.516 / Virus Database: 269.17.13/1214 - Release Date: 08/01/2008
  13:38
 
 
  No virus found in this outgoing message.
  Checked by AVG Free Edition.
  Version: 7.5.516 / Virus Database: 269.17.13/1214 - Release Date: 08/01/2008
  13:38
 
 
  -
  Histórico: http://www.fug.com.br/historico/html/freebsd/
  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
 


 --
 Marcio Gomes
 = = = = = = = = = = = = = = = =
 Powered by 

  (__)
   \\\'',)
 \/  \ ^
 .\._/_)
 ==
 Linux is for people who hate Windows,
 BSD is for people who love UNIX

 * Windows: Where do you want to go tomorrow?
 * Linux: Where do you want to go today?
 * FreeBSD: Are you, guys, comming or what?
 -
 Histórico: 

Re: [FUG-BR] RES: como fazer um controle de banda DUPLO

2008-01-09 Por tôpico Marcio Antunes
não seria pq 6,4 é Kbytes e 64 é kbits. ??

Em 09/01/08, Cobausque[EMAIL PROTECTED] escreveu:
 Ei uma duvida .. porque no script você usa no queue 6,4Kbytes por exemplo
 pro micro com 64K em ???
 E assim respectivamente?

 -Mensagem original-
 De: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] Em nome
 de Alessandro de Souza Rocha
 Enviada em: segunda-feira, 7 de janeiro de 2008 19:14
 Para: Lista Brasileira de Discussão sobre FreeBSD (FUG-BR)
 Assunto: Re: [FUG-BR] como fazer um controle de banda DUPLO
 
 Em 07/01/08, Samyr Alves[EMAIL PROTECTED] escreveu:
  Ola Amigo,
 
  da uma olhada em
 
  http://www.openbsd.org/faq/pf/pt/queueing.html
 
  sds
  samyr
 
 
  Em 07/01/08, Alex Almeida [EMAIL PROTECTED] escreveu:
  
   Boa tarde a todos, é o seguinte gostaria de entender como fazer um
   controle de banda DUPLO, vou tentar exemplificar isso abaixo:
  
   O cliente compra o serviço de internet de 256kbits, porem quer que seja
   limitada a banda de determinados ips na sua rede:
  
   Rede do cliente: 192.168.0.0/29 (1 gateway + 5 ips) - 256kbits
  
   192.168.0.2 - IP 1 - Limitado ate 128kbits
   192.168.0.3 - IP 2 - Limitado ate 64kbits
   192.168.0.4 - IP 3 - Limitado ate 64kbits
   192.168.0.5 - IP 4 - Limitado ate 256kbits
   192.168.0.6 - IP 5 - Limitado ate 256kbits
  
   O total deste IPs acima dará 768kbits porem a banda total do link
   fornecido será de 256kbits, no momento que algum usuário necessitar
   utilizar a banda ele ficara limitado a velocidade disponível no momento.
   Exemplo:
  
   o IP .4 vai efetuar um download com ate 64kbits, mesmo que o link esteja
   todo livre no momento.
   o IP .5 vai efetuar um download com ate 256kbits, se o link estiver todo
   livre no momento, caso contrario o próprio roteamento faz o
 balanceamento.
  
   No aguardo,
  
   Alex Almeida
  
  
   -
   Histórico: http://www.fug.com.br/historico/html/freebsd/
   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
  
 
 
 
  --
  QQ duvida estarei aki para ajudar, obrigado, t+
 
  []´s, Samyr Alves
  Gd Internet
  Analista de Redes e Telecomunicação
  NOC - Network Operation Center
  E-mail / MSN Messenger: [EMAIL PROTECTED]
  Web Site: www.gd.com.br
  Office + 55 75 3223 5018
  Toll Free   0800 701 5018
  Mobile + 55 75 8127 2320
  Feira de Santana - Bahia - Brazil
 
  - Em qualquer situação e diante de qualquer circunstância, preserve a
  integridade do seu caráter
  -
  Histórico: http://www.fug.com.br/historico/html/freebsd/
  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d
 

 ipfw add 1000 pipe 1 src-ip 192.168.0.2 out
 ipfw add 1100 pipe 2 dst-ip 192.168.0.2  in
 ipfw pipe 1 config mask src-ip 0x00ff bw 128Kbit/s queue 12,8KBytes
 ipfw pipe 2 config mask dst-ip 0x00ff bw 128Kbit/s queue 12,8KBytes

 ipfw add 1001 pipe 3 src-ip 192.168.0.3 out
 ipfw add 1102 pipe 4 dst-ip 192.168.0.3 in
 ipfw pipe 1 config mask src-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
 ipfw pipe 2 config mask dst-ip 0x00ff bw 64Kbit/s queue 6,4KBytes

 ipfw add 1003 pipe 5 src-ip 192.168.0.4 out
 ipfw add 1104 pipe 6 dst-ip 192.168.0.4 in
 ipfw pipe 1 config mask src-ip 0x00ff bw 64Kbit/s queue 6,4KBytes
 ipfw pipe 2 config mask dst-ip 0x00ff bw 64Kbit/s queue 6,4KBytes

 --
 Alessandro de Souza Rocha
 Administrador de Redes e Sistemas
 Freebsd-BR User #117
 -
 Histórico: http://www.fug.com.br/historico/html/freebsd/
 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d

 No virus found in this incoming message.
 Checked by AVG Free Edition.
 Version: 7.5.516 / Virus Database: 269.17.13/1214 - Release Date: 08/01/2008
 13:38


 No virus found in this outgoing message.
 Checked by AVG Free Edition.
 Version: 7.5.516 / Virus Database: 269.17.13/1214 - Release Date: 08/01/2008
 13:38


 -
 Histórico: http://www.fug.com.br/historico/html/freebsd/
 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d



-- 
Marcio Gomes
= = = = = = = = = = = = = = = =
Powered by 

 (__)
  \\\'',)
\/  \ ^
.\._/_)
==
Linux is for people who hate Windows,
BSD is for people who love UNIX

* Windows: Where do you want to go tomorrow?
* Linux: Where do you want to go today?
* FreeBSD: Are you, guys, comming or what?
-
Histórico: http://www.fug.com.br/historico/html/freebsd/
Sair da lista: https://www.fug.com.br/mailman/listinfo/freebsd